Katovision Inc
111 Star St Ste 101
Mankato, MN 56001
Katovision Inc is your neighborhood eye doctor located at 111 Star St. Your Mankato eyecare center offers genuine eye care where your eye health and wellness is our primary focus.
Annual eye exams are a recommended cornerstone for ensuring the health of your eyes...
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.